**Ceremony step 7 — Pricewheel experiment keys.**

Before enabling the Pricewheel ticket-pricing experiment on the Glimmerhall venue platform, two custodians must be present in the sealed room. Verify the hardware token's tamper strip is intact, confirm the experiment flag bundle hash against the printed manifest, and have the witness initial the log. As the new contractor, you sign last. Only then may the experiment signing key be generated. The recovery passphrase used to reconstitute that key in an emergency appears immediately below.

recovery phrase for fahif-yawig: fenvan-praox-wenax-pramir-prair-tamix-rusiel-casdor-julir-novys-fenmir-sorius-kelix

INTERNAL MEMO — Incoming Director

Re: Branwell Coffeeworks franchise agreement

The Thistledown location signed a ten-year term with standard royalty of 6%. Build-out deadline is March; fixtures sourced through our Orley depot. Renewal options remain open. Two clauses are still under negotiation with their counsel. One item requires your attention before the countersigning meeting.

management briefing: The renewal with Zoraelax Group closes at $10 million a year, 15 percent below the last contract. Project Ralael slips by six weeks because of the audit delay.

## Formula sandbox tuning

User-supplied formulas in Gridmoor execute inside a restricted interpreter with hard ceilings on time, memory, and call depth. Reviewers should confirm any change to these ceilings is justified in the PR description, since raising them widens the abuse surface. Defaults were chosen from production traces. The current limits are as follows.

limits module of tafog-fawip:
WEIGHTS = {
    "julix": 57,
    "lamys": 992,
    "kasvan": 209,
    "quenok": 750,
    "alddor": 259,
    "oliath": 1009,
    "wenix": 815,
}